The “Education for democracy” training activity presented in “Henri Coanda” Highschool Craiova, Romania

A presentation on the “Education for democracy” module was held at “Henri Coanda” Highschool on the 2nd of October 2017 by English teacher Sonia Dobre, volunteer at Edulife Association, participant in the training activity that took place in Barcelona meeting from 18 tot 22 September 2017. This presentation was attended by more than 50 people who responded very positively to the activity. First, the idea, the objectives and the outcomes of the project were presented. Then Sonia talked about the training week in Barcelona, about the training activities, the interactive workshops, the visits to local institutions. Finally, she elaborated the whole formative effect the training had on the participants.

Next, Sonia introduced an interactive workshop in which all the participants were involved. This workshop was inspired by the “Education for personal development” theme “It’s better to be a rainbow”. Its purpose was to give the participants a clear and helpful insight on the whole New Educations concept such as it is promoted in the Erasmus+ project “THE NEW EDUCATIONS IN PROMOTING TRANSVERSAL SKILLS”. The whole day was a success: all participants were very interested in the themes and modules and the intellectual outputs of the project.
